1. Check whether the board is made of genuine material

The market is flooded with counterfeit products made by small workshops, often at low prices and low quality, designed to deceive ordinary buyers. Standard panel cabinets should be at least 17mm thick. Often, small workshops use particleboard as high-density board to falsely advertise panel cabinets as only 16mm thick, claiming they are 18mm. The standard back panel thickness should be 9mm, and the door panels should also be 9mm thick.

2. Look at the cross section of the board

The easiest way to tell whether a wardrobe is made of high-density fiberboard (HDF) or particleboard is to examine the cross-section of the board. This means the fine fibers in HDF are tightly packed together, resulting in a higher density and heavier weight. HDF can withstand significant pressure and has a longer lifespan. Particleboard, on the other hand, has a looser structure of fine particles, making it lighter, less able to bear weight, and shorter in lifespan.

3. Also see whether the board base material meets environmental protection standards

The free formaldehyde content in the wood panel should be ≤0.5 mg/L, which means it is classified as European E0 environmental grade, which is harmless to human health. To check, open all cabinet doors and drawers and observe if there is a strong odor. If there is a strong odor, the formaldehyde content is very high. You can also check the material testing certificate of the manufacturer to see if it has been certified by the National Manufactured Goods Quality Testing Center.
